摘要
Wavelet Packet Modulation (WPM) was proposed as one of the multicarrier transmission methods like OFDM. Since it is a multicarrier transmission method, however, it has a high peak to averaged power ratio (PAPR). For improving PAPR of OFDM, the Single Carrier OFDM (SC-OFDM) method was proposed and it is expected that the principle of SC-OFDM can be used in WPM. In this paper, we consider applying the WPM to satellite communications. The BER performance of WPM and OFDM in a fading channel is compared, and it is shown that the performance of WPM is better than OFDM. Then, we propose the Single Carrier WPM (SC-WPM) method that applies the principle of SC-OFDM to WPM to remedy the PAPR, and show that the performance is improved substantially.
